Balsamic Vinegar Reduction Recipe

This is one of the best little sauces I have made in a while - if you like the tang of balsamic vinegar you will find many different uses for this sauce

Ingredients
  • 2 cups Balsamic Vinegar (make sure you use a good one like Modena)
  • 1/4 Cup sugar
  • pinch of salt

Directions
  1. Over medium high heat bring to a rolling boil - stir until sugar is dissolved and continue to cook until reduced to 1/3 - 1/4 cup this is very potent and a little goes a long way - I love to serve it over fresh cut strawberries with a dolpe of fresh whip cream!!!!!
